The Customer Facing Supply Chain Specialist (B2B) ensures flawless execution of the order-to-cash process, compliance with contractual standards and delivery of high service levels to Trade and B2B customers. These B2B customers include Hotels, Restaurants, Cafes, Cruise Ships and other large B2B businesses. This role focuses on operational excellence, chargeback prevention and cost-to-serve optimization, while leveraging AI and automation tools to improve productivity and accuracy. The Customer Facing Supply Chain Specialist will also support continuous improvement initiatives and collaborates with internal teams and external partners to sustain efficiency and customer satisfaction. Responsibilities:

Execute and Monitor Order-to-Cash Process

• Process customer orders accurately and on time, ensuring compliance with agreed standards and Terms & Conditions.
• Validate order details and pricing using AI-powered anomaly detection tools.
• Track OTIF performance daily and escalate risks proactively.
• Use AI Agents to automate repetitive tasks such as order confirmations and delivery status updates.
• Serve as the single point of contact for order-related inquiries, ensuring timely communication and resolution of issues across internal teams and external partners.

Support Cost-to-Serve Optimization and Chargeback Management

• Validate and manage chargebacks, ensuring accurate documentation and timely dispute resolution.
• Analyze cost drivers and propose improvements to reduce cost-to-serve.
• Apply AI-driven analytics to detect patterns in chargebacks and predict risk areas.
• Collaborate with finance and logistics teams to implement corrective actions.
• Act as the single point of contact for cost-to-serve and chargeback inquiries, ensuring clear communication and alignment between customers and internal stakeholders.

Ensure Compliance and Contractual Standards

• Maintain adherence to Supply Chain standards defined in contracts with retailers and partners.
• Document all processes and decisions to ensure audit readiness.
• Use AI-based compliance monitoring tools to flag deviations proactively.
• Support periodic reviews of Terms & Conditions and update operational workflows accordingly.

Deliver Data-Driven Insights and Reporting

• Prepare and update dashboards on OTIF, cost-to-serve, and chargeback performance.
• Use SQL, Python, and AI tools to automate reporting and generate predictive insights.
• Implement AI Agents for real-time monitoring and automated alerts on service risks.
• Provide actionable recommendations to improve operational efficiency and customer experience.

Support Continuous Improvement and Collaboration

• Participate in NCE-driven initiatives to improve processes and reduce manual workload.
• Collaborate with DSP, Logistics, Transportation, and Commercial teams to ensure seamless execution.
• Use AI Agents to streamline communication and task management across teams.
• Contribute ideas for automation and digital transformation projects.

We can trace our origin back to 1866, when the first European condensed milk factory was opened in Cham, Switzerland, by the Anglo-Swiss Condensed Milk Company. One year later, Henri Nestlé, a trained pharmacist, launched one of the world’s first prepared infant cereals ‘Farine lactée’ in Vevey, Switzerland.

Today, we employ around 273,000 people and have factories or operations in almost every country in the world. With our headquarters still based in the Swiss town of Vevey, we had sales of CHF 84.3 billion in 2020.
